Forensic Science Quiz: Practice Test Cheat Sheet
- Understanding DNA Analysis - DNA profiling, pioneered by Sir Alec Jeffreys in 1984, allows us to match genetic fingerprints and solve mysteries at the molecular level. It's the gold standard for personal identification in modern forensics. Keep this technique in your toolkit for cracking cold cases! Forensic Science Wiki
- Fingerprint Identification - Fingerprints are like personal barcodes - they never repeat and last a lifetime. Forensics experts dust and lift these prints to link suspects to crime scenes. Master the whorls and loops and you'll crack cases with style! TXCTE Study Guide
- Bloodstain Pattern Analysis - Blood splatters can tell dramatic stories: the angle, velocity, and shape reveal what happened and where people stood. Investigating patterns helps you reconstruct crime scenes like a detective artist. Get your interpretation skills sharp and you'll read the scene in red! Biology4Me Forensic Guide
- Forensic Toxicology - Detective work in a test tube - this field finds drugs, alcohol, and poisons in bodies to piece together causes of death or impairment. By mastering chemical analysis, you can tell if a substance changed the game. Keep those reagents ready for your own toxic drama! TXCTE Toxicology Module
- Trace Evidence Analysis - Tiny clues like hair, fibers, or glass shards can link suspects to scenes. By examining these micro pieces under the microscope, you become a sleuth that sees what others miss. Sharpen your eagle eyes for those hidden goldmines of proof! TXCTE Trace Evidence Guide
- Ballistics and Firearms Examination - Guns and bullets leave signatures - studying rifling marks and trajectories helps pinpoint the exact weapon used. By lining up striations and angles, you bring hard science to courtroom battles. Aim your knowledge like a magnifying glass on the truth! TXCTE Ballistics Primer
- Forensic Anthropology - Bones never lie - studying skeletal remains reveals age, sex, ancestry, and sometimes cause of death. You can reconstruct faces, estimate stature, and even tell if trauma occurred before or after death. Get ready to turn human jigsaws into solved portraits! TXCTE Anthropology Notes
- Digital Forensics - In the age of gadgets, criminals leave digital footprints on phones, computers, and servers. By recovering deleted files and tracing IP logs, you can unravel cyber mysteries and crimes. Level up your hacking-spy skills for good! CliffsNotes Digital Forensics
- Crime Scene Investigation - Securing the scene is where every investigation begins - mistakes here spoil the evidence buffet. Learn proper protocols for photographing, collecting, and preserving clues to keep your case airtight. Don that forensic lab coat and treat each scene like a treasure hunt! CliffsNotes CSI Guide
- Forensic Entomology - Bugs at a crime scene are more than creepy crawlies - they're tiny clocks that help estimate time of death. Knowing which insects arrive first and in what order turns decomposition into a timeline. Roll out your insect encyclopedias and get buzzing! TXCTE Entomology Resource
